Output 76c489afbf758012aaf35da2a50ac136af1481dfeb0aefaa86e565372def4a54:1

value
999890
script pubkey
OP_0 OP_PUSHBYTES_20 30895c5c197c3f6431d595919735d50e8a8536e6
address
bc1qxzy4chqe0slkgvw4jkgewdw4p69g2dhxydpqhs
transaction
76c489afbf758012aaf35da2a50ac136af1481dfeb0aefaa86e565372def4a54